If it ends on the 16th April, you've been able to upgrade since the 17th of March, so might be worth giving them a ring and see if they can do you any discounts (might be cheaper than moving to another network, try them and see).
In regards to O2 ringing you, as a network we don't do that, I always found it rude and annoying when Three and the other networks used to keep ringing me trying to pressure me into an upgrade, so it's nice to know they let you take your own time.
You have to give 30 day notice over the phone to cancel it, which again you've been able to do since the 17th of March.

1) Yes I do work for O2 (but the opinions and advice I post here is entirely my own and not representative of that of the company I work for) <-- have to put that to cover myself lol
2) No, it's not 'too late', this seems to be a common mis-conception, although I have no idea why... An '18-month' contract is just your MINIMUM contract, you can have it for 18-months, 20-months, 50-months, the rest of your life if you want to lol, it won't just 'end' and you won't be tied in again if you do nothing. Once you're past your minimum commitment period (18-months) then it's up to YOU what you do.
3) You can't transfer it to someone elses name, but if you're going to do that you may as well just cancel it and get him to start his own contract.
4) O2's retentions team is one of the best in the country, but if you don't get the answer you want from one person, hang up and try another. But bear in mind, they're not miracle workers, don't expect to get shed loads of minutes, texts and Internet, plus a top end phone, for a couple of quid per month. The longer you've been with O2, the more haggeling power you have. You've only been with them 18-months, but in another 18-months you'll prolly get a better deal than this time.
